WebTth DNA Ligase catalyzes the NAD-dependent formation of phosphodiester bonds between adjacent 3’ hydroxyl and 5’-phosphate termini in double stranded DNA. It is not active against single stranded DNA or RNA and blunt ended DNA. Enzyme is isolated from Escherichia coli strain containing plasmid carrying the Thermus thermophilus DNA ligase …

WebLigases catalyze the formation of phosphodiester bond between 3′OH and 5′phosphate on various substrates such as DNA nicks, DNA fragments with various lengths cohesive ends, DNA fragments with blunt ends and some DNA/RNA hybrids.
